用matlab如何拟合曲线,用MATLAB怎么实现曲线拟合?
MATLAB软件提供了基本的曲线拟合函数的命令.
1 多项式函数拟合:a=polyfit(xdata,ydata,n)
其中n表示多项式的最高阶数,xdata,ydata为将要拟合的数据,它是用数组的方式输入.输出参数a为拟合多项式 的系数
多项式在x处的值y可用下面程序计算.
y=polyval(a,x)
2 一般的曲线拟合:p=curvefit(‘Fun’,p0,xdata,ydata)
其中Fun表示函数Fun(p,data)的M函数文件,p0表示函数的初值.curvefit()命令的求解问题形式是
若要求解点x处的函数值可用程序f=Fun(p,x)计算.
例如已知函数形式 ,并且已知数据点 要确定四个未知参数a,b,c,d.
使用curvefit命令,数据输入 ;初值输 ;并且建立函数 的M文件(Fun.m).若定义 ,则输出
又如引例的求解,MATLAB程序:
t=[l:16]; %数据输人
y=[ 4 6.4 8 8.4 9.28 9.5 9.7 9.86 10.2 10.32 10.42 10.5 10.55 10.58 10.6] ;
plot(t,y,’o’) %画散点图
p=polyfit(t,y,2) (二次多项式拟合)
计算结果:
p=-0.0445 1.0711 4.3252 %二次多项式的系数
由此得到某化合物的浓度y与时间t的拟合函数。
◆◆
评论读取中....
请登录后再发表评论!
◆◆
修改失败,请稍后尝试
用matlab如何拟合曲线,用MATLAB怎么实现曲线拟合?相关推荐
- matlab拟合曲线用什么,【Matlab】matlab如何使用拟合工具?matlab如何拟合曲线?matlab拟合工具cftool如何使用?...
网上教程有好有坏,我自己总结了一个笔记 目录 1.打开方式 2. 打开界面 3.输入数据 4.选择拟合方式 5.选择拟合时需要几阶? 6.查看拟合效果 7.绘图显示 8.保存拟合数据 9.如何使用拟合 ...
- 2021-02-28 Matlab优化拟合曲线
Matlab优化拟合曲线 分享一下使用非线性函数对数据进行拟合.非线性函数假定是标准指数衰减曲线, y(t)=Aexp(−λt) 其中,y(t) 是时间 t 时的响应,A 和 λ 是要拟合的参数.对曲 ...
- matlab 画非线性曲线,MATLAB实例:非线性曲线拟合
MATLAB实例:非线性曲线拟合 用最小二乘法拟合非线性曲线,给出两种方法:(1)指定非线性函数,(2)用傅里叶函数拟合曲线 1. MATLAB程序 clear clc xdata=[0.1732;0 ...
- 用Matlab求二次多项式,matlab二次多项式拟合
用matlab做散点的二次曲线拟合_数学_自然科学_专业资料.例 对下面一组数据作二次多项式拟合 xi 0.1 0.2 0.4 0.5 0.6 0.7 0.8 0.9 1 yi 1.978 ..... ...
- matlab 变量代入数值,matlab将数值代入函数
如何在 MATLAB 中根据有限的数据点得到函数悬赏分:100 | 提问时间:2010-5-24 07:28 | 提问者:aptxyuchen 如何在 MATLAB 中根据有限的数据点得到函数推荐答案 ...
- 怎么把dll库写成MATLAB接口,如何在Matlab中应用动态连接库接口技术
1 引言 Matlab是当前应用最为广泛的数学软件,具有强大的数值计算.数据分析处理.系统 分析.图形显示甚至符号运算等功能.利用这一完整的数学平台,用户可以快速实现十分 复杂的功能,极大地提高工程分 ...
- matlab 汽车 流场,matlab画流场图
基于 Matlab 分布式工具箱的流场计算及其可视化 蔡群;周美莲;段杰峰;李青... 基于 MATLAB 和 CFD 数据库的流场可视化的实现 [J], 晏畅 5.基于 VB 与 MATLAB 混合 ...
- 目标层准则层MATLAB,层次分析法-MATLAB
层次分析法-MATLAB 第八章 层次分析法 层次分析法(Analytic Hierarchy Process,简称AHP)是对一些较为复杂.较为模糊的问题作出决策的简易方法,它特别适用于那些难于完全 ...
- matlab提excel文字,matlab读取excel文字
数据导入| 将excel数据导入matlab_计算机软件及应用_IT/计算机_专业资料.将 excel 数据导入 matlab 一. 将 excel 文本放在 matlab 的 work 文件夹里面. ...
最新文章
- Linux 使用ps命令查看某个进程文件的启动位置
- app.vue里使用data_Python爬虫使用正则爬取网站,正则都不会就别玩爬虫了!
- jQuery -- touch事件之滑动判断(左右上下方向)
- HDU - 2296 Ring(AC自动机+dp)
- 项目管理 计算机仿真,分析计算机仿真技术在工程项目施工管理中的运用.pdf
- Java并发教程–重入锁
- 小程序用户拒绝授权解决方法
- codeforces Round #320 (Div. 2) C. A Problem about Polyline(数学) D. Or Game(暴力,数学)
- 作者:连德富,男,电子科技大学讲师、教育大数据研究所副所长。
- 【零基础学Java】—数组(五)
- [LeetCode] 159. Longest Substring with At Most Two Distinct Characters 最多有两个不同字符的最长子串...
- Spring+IOC(DI)+AOP概念及优缺点
- java hashtable 修改_Java Hashtable computeIfAbsent()用法及代码示例
- lede 内核 单 编_openwrt和lede有何区别?
- 【专栏必读】王道考研408操作系统+Linux系统编程万字笔记、题目题型总结、注意事项、目录导航和思维导图
- 115网盘播放html5,新版115网盘加强个人社交功能 支持Html5技术
- linux蜂鸣器驱动
- PNG,JPEG,BMP,JIF图片格式详解及其对比
- 【淘宝补单】操作干预单不能在犯的错误
- vue路由守卫死循环及next原理解释
热门文章
- 第三部分 项目整合管理
- OpenKE 的使用(四)— HolE 和 ComplEx 论文复现
- 免费GPU汇总及选购
- 索引服务器(全文索引)的使用
- 昊海微信拼团php,最新微信昊海拼团系统独立版源码分享,微信团购关注送红包送优惠卷功能,附说明文档...
- c++基础知识的学习--函数探幽
- 继续教育统考英语计算机监考严吗,网络教育统考监考严吗
- java页面数值转文本_Java读取Excel表格以及读取数字列转为文本的解决办法
- linux 桌面环境推荐,8种最佳的Ubuntu桌面环境(18.04 Bionic Beaver Linux)
- JQuery Mobile试试水